Interface Resource

All Known Implementing Classes:
ResourceImpl

@Environment(CLIENT)
public interface Resource
Mappings:
Namespace Name
official bnh
intermediary net/minecraft/class_1257
named net/minecraft/resource/Resource
  • Method Details

    • getId

      Identifier getId()
      Mappings:
      Namespace Name Mixin selector
      official a Lbnh;a()Ljy;
      intermediary method_4358 Lnet/minecraft/class_1257;method_4358()Lnet/minecraft/class_1605;
      named getId Lnet/minecraft/resource/Resource;getId()Lnet/minecraft/util/Identifier;
    • getInputStream

      InputStream getInputStream()
      Mappings:
      Namespace Name Mixin selector
      official b Lbnh;b()Ljava/io/InputStream;
      intermediary method_4360 Lnet/minecraft/class_1257;method_4360()Ljava/io/InputStream;
      named getInputStream Lnet/minecraft/resource/Resource;getInputStream()Ljava/io/InputStream;
    • hasMetadata

      boolean hasMetadata()
      Mappings:
      Namespace Name Mixin selector
      official c Lbnh;c()Z
      intermediary method_4361 Lnet/minecraft/class_1257;method_4361()Z
      named hasMetadata Lnet/minecraft/resource/Resource;hasMetadata()Z
    • getMetadata

      <T extends ResourceMetadataProvider> T getMetadata​(String key)
      Mappings:
      Namespace Name Mixin selector
      official a Lbnh;a(Ljava/lang/String;)Lbnw;
      intermediary method_4359 Lnet/minecraft/class_1257;method_4359(Ljava/lang/String;)Lnet/minecraft/class_1273;
      named getMetadata Lnet/minecraft/resource/Resource;getMetadata(Ljava/lang/String;)Lnet/minecraft/client/resource/ResourceMetadataProvider;
    • getResourcePackName

      String getResourcePackName()
      Mappings:
      Namespace Name Mixin selector
      official d Lbnh;d()Ljava/lang/String;
      intermediary method_4362 Lnet/minecraft/class_1257;method_4362()Ljava/lang/String;
      named getResourcePackName Lnet/minecraft/resource/Resource;getResourcePackName()Ljava/lang/String;